Hans Springer formed in Porto Alegre, Brazil around 2007, with Hans Springer himself on vocals alongside André Sandrini and Leo Dex. They put out their first album, 'Contradiversos,' in 2010. The band's sound pulls from folk and hard rock, mixing ethereal melodies with raw guitar work and lyrics that often circle love and loss.
Their second album, 'Amanhã,' came out in 2013. The title track 'Amanhã' became a hit in Brazil, known for its haunting melody and melancholic feel. The song's success brought the band wider attention, though the existing history suggests this period also brought some internal strain.
